Jan 204 statement upon securing a renewal of the trial license;
“This is extremely welcome news, which our management and legal team have been working on tirelessly over the past months. The agreement reached in July 2023 with the indigenous communities has been a pivotal moment in permitting success at Coringa followed by a further agreement with all parties signed in December 2023 and sanctioned by the court allowing the ANM and SEMAS to renew the existing licences.
The new GU allows us to continue our current operations and importantly we are allowed to install the planned crusher and ore sorter under this and the accompanying GUOL. Whilst the permit has an annual limitation of 50,000 tonnes of ore that can be transported per annum from the mine, this would be sufficient for 2024, whilst we now focus on completing the final steps to complete the full permitting at Coringa.“
